FINANCE REVIEW SUMMARY — Dunmore & Fell Pilot

Quick recap for department heads: the pilot with Dunmore & Fell is tracking well. Margins came in at 34%, a touch above plan, and fulfilment costs stayed flat. Inventory turns look healthy across all five trial stores. Jonas Akerly wants a decision on scaling by month-end. See the note below before circulating anything.

internal memo for yahag-hahig: Belwynix Group plans to lower the Silir list price by 62 percent in May.

14:22 — Paybright export job began emitting the new fixed-width payroll format while downstream parsers still expected CSV. Reviewer note: the format flag was flipped in config, not code, so diff review missed it. Mitigation: config changes now require the same review gate. The deploy responsible is identified by the token below.

pipeline stamp: htk9_ce63042d9

Runbook: Account recovery for Gatewren canary gating

Hey reviewer — quick refresher. Gatewren blocks canary promotion unless error budgets hold for 30 minutes. If the gating account locks out (three bad auth attempts), promotions freeze entirely, so recovery is time-sensitive. Reset the account via the Thornvale admin shell, then re-arm the gates manually. The shell prompts for the recovery passphrase, recorded immediately below.

unlock words, bahop-fawef: novmir-druwyn-soriel-rusdor-kasion

## Tuning

The Lentowire payments suite's integration tests are sensitive to ledger-settlement timing, which caused the flakiness seen in recent release candidates. We now gate retries and backoff centrally so the release manager can adjust them without code changes. Raise values cautiously; overly generous timeouts mask real regressions. The defaults we ship with are defined below.

limits module of tafop-hahop:
WEIGHTS = {
    "julmir": 223,
    "belox": 987,
    "lamion": 470,
    "pelath": 609,
    "fraok": 1010,
    "eliion": 343,
    "drudor": 342,
}